Asherons Call: Arcane Knowledge 2 and Author's Rights

An interesting situation came up the other day that once again talks about the authors rights to prevent specific users from using their product. This issue revolved around Arcane Knowledge 2 and its author, Hazridi. Many may not have been aware of this, I personally was not, but Hazridi added code to the plugin to prevent specific users from using his plugin, essentially banning people from using it. This was to provide a consequence for some users actions in the game, something that isn't always possible on the NPK worlds. The original version of this code warned users that they were banned from using AK2 and that their hard drive was being formatted, but AK2 never contained any malware, or malicious code of that kind. All that was intended to happen was that the buttons in AK2 would be disabled, although some reported that it would crash their game client as well. Unfortunately, an innocent bystander was caught in Hazridi's routine, as was detailed in this thread, but fortunately Hazridi quickly fixed his routine so that the player was able to use his software. This does bring up memories of the ACScript situation, however that apparently did contain malicious code, not just a false warning. It should be noted that AK2 will still crash your game client if you have the Character Stats filter disabled, but any Decal plugin will crash, taking your game client with it, if you have a filter it needs disabled. I'm sure the plugin needs your character stats for more than just determining if you are banned or not.

This seems to be interesting to debate, but in the end it is for the author to decide how his program will be used, within certain bounds of course.
